Latest Patents

One of his latest patents is titled "System and method for improved automated semiconductor wafer manufacturing." This invention provides a method for aligning a photolithographic machine in an automated semiconductor manufacturing system. The method includes identifying a maximum precision degree for a wafer and determining a maximum overlay correction value. It simulates various algorithms to ascertain whether an algorithm aligns a leading lot within specified alignment parameters. Ultimately, the method aligns a photolithography machine using an algorithm selected based on these simulations.

Another notable patent is also focused on automated semiconductor manufacturing. This system includes a smart overlay control (SOC) database that contains empirical alignment data related to overlay alignment. A simulation module is connected to the SOC database, determining a simulated overlay alignment of a wafer across multiple photolithography tools. Additionally, a dispatch module controls the dispatch of a wafer to one of these tools based on the simulated overlay alignment.
